Welcome to Härnösand, Sweden! Upon arriving at the port in Härnösand, you will find that it is a tender port. From the port area, visitors can take a short walk to reach the city center. The charming town of Härnösand offers a picturesque setting with its historic buildings and scenic waterfront. For those looking to explore further beyond the city center, there are public buses available for transportation. Bus line 30 operates in Härnösand and provides convenient access to various parts of the city. Visitors can catch bus 30 at stops located near the port area. The cost for a bus ride in Härnösand is typically around 25 SEK (Swedish Krona) per ticket. Travelers can purchase tickets directly from the bus driver upon boarding.
